The majority of mesothelioma patients are able to file a personal injuries lawsuit against asbestos companies who exposed them to the disease. The majority of lawsuits fall in two categories: economic and non-economic damages. The financial damages awarded in the first category are based upon the cost of treatment and lost income as also documented expenses related to a mesothelioma diagnoses. Noneconomic damages, on the other hand, are awarded to compensate a plaintiff for their emotional and physical anxiety, suffering as well as loss of enjoyment life and other intangible losses.

Personal injury lawsuits

Patients with mesothelioma may be able to sue the companies that exposed them to asbestos. These lawsuits are designed to hold companies accountable for their negligence. They also offer compensation for medical expenses, lost income and other losses. Mesothelioma patients could file an injury lawsuit while they are alive, and in certain states, the lawsuit may be pursued by their estate representatives after the death of the patient.

In the mesothelioma litigation process, victims will work with experienced attorneys who can help them find evidence of asbestos exposure from past employers. The plaintiff will need to collect documentation, including work history as well as medical records and testimonies from co-workers and family members. This information will be used to determine the claim's value.

When a mesothelioma lawsuit is filed, the defendant named in the suit will have an enumeration period of time to respond. The time frame for responding to mesothelioma claims varies from state to state. The defendant may choose to settle out of court with the plaintiff, or refute the claims, which will begin the trial process.

If the defendant is unable settle with the plaintiff, he will be required by law to pay a specific amount of money to the victim. This is referred to as a compensation award. The money is usually paid in a lump sum and is used to pay for medical bills, loss of income, funeral expenses. Mesothelioma compensation awards can also cover non-economic damages, such as pain and suffering, as well as loss of consortium.

While there have been few class action lawsuits, most mesothelioma cases are dealt with in individual lawsuits. However, some of these cases may be combined into a multidistrict litigation or MDL to improve efficiency.

Disability benefits

Compensation for mesothelioma could aid patients and their families as well as caregivers pay for living expenses such as household bills, income loss, caregiving, and other related costs. It also provides financial security in the event of death. The three major types of mesothelioma settlements are trust funds, lawsuits and settlements. If a mesothelioma patient is able to meet the SSDI eligibility requirements They will be required to submit medical documentation supporting their diagnosis. The best proof is the results of a pathology test which identifies cancer cells from a biopsy. However, other documents that can prove the disease include hospital documents, doctor's notes and letters from family members.

Before granting disability benefits, the SSA will also evaluate the prognosis of the patient and evaluate their capacity to work. If a mesothelioma patient is incapable of working then they are entitled to monthly disability checks. These benefits are determined by the average of their lifetime earnings they have paid into Social Security. Mesothelioma patients may also be qualified for state-based disability benefits and supplemental assistance, which is not funded through Social Security taxes.
